Summer 2019 Development and Management Internship

Circle of Confusion is looking for driven, organized interns who are seeking careers in the entertainment business to intern in the Los Angeles office two or three days a week for the Summer 2019 semester. Interns will be exposed to industry practices that go into developing, producing and casting films, TV, and theater. More specifically, interns will be involved in reading scripts, writing coverage, conducting industry related research, answering phones, taking on general office work and assisting with special projects which can include editing video for reels and creating web pages. Interns will have the opportunity to shadow assistants, sit down with managers and/or producers, ask questions and ultimately, through the course of the internship, learn what it means to be on the business side of entertainment. As an intern, you must be able to receive credit for the internship. Circle of Confusion is a literary and talent management and production company. We represent high profile actors, directors and writers as well as produce award-winning television programs and films. Circle is an innovative and growing company, whose unique brand continues to establish it as a powerful force in the entertainment industry. Applicants should be highly driven, self-motivated individuals looking to immerse themselves in a management and production environment. Upbeat, friendly, and positive attitude is a MUST.

Responsibilities:
Administrative tasks (making copies, scanning, faxing, filing, creating/updating binders and Excel spreadsheets); Cover phones and fill in for Front Desk when necessary; Assist Managers and Assistants with special projects; Research for various projects; Development material coverage (scripts, books, and treatments) and casting breakdowns; Generating social media; Assist with office runs, deliveries, and pickups.

Eligibility Requirements:
  • Must be eligible to receive credit
  • Must be able to intern 2 - 3 full days (9:30am - 6:30pm PST) at our Culver City headquarters
  • Attendance at a mandatory orientation at the beginning of the semester
  • Must be available to intern through the end of the term, currently August 23. Upon acceptance, your internship end date will be flexible between August 12 - August 23.
